Crossing the rocky mountains of the Aegean in Ikaria

At the sound of the word "Ikaria", the mind travels to hot summers and people who do not stop cooling off on its beaches.
But what if you decide to visit this island in winter?
Then you will need a warm jacket, because you will have the opportunity to discover its seductive mountain landscape, with the rocky areas that challenge you to cross them.
So tie your boots and go up the slopes that offer a privileged view of the coast of Ikaria, to meet a place that most were not lucky enough to know it existed.
Do not hesitate to visit Plagia, Xylosyrtis, Pezi, Halari's gorge and Prophitis Elias. The mountainous profile of Ikaria is an untouched place. The winter side of a stereotypically summer coin.
Thus, a challenge for every traveler.
